What safety measures are in place for dining in during health crises?

BJ's Restaurants has implemented several safety measures to ensure the well-being of its guests and staff during health crises. These measures typically include enhanced cleaning protocols, with a focus on high-touch areas and surfaces being sanitized frequently. Social distancing guidelines are often followed, limiting seating capacity to provide adequate spacing between tables. Employees are usually required to wear masks and practice good hygiene, including regular handwashing. BJ's may also screen employees for symptoms and provide training on health and safety best practices.
Additionally, BJ's Restaurants often offer contactless payment options and encourages reservations to minimize wait times and large gatherings. Guests may notice signage regarding health protocols within the restaurant to remind everyone of the measures in place. For the most current information and specific practices, it is suggested to check the official BJ's Restaurants website.
